Mitha Tiwana climate — normals and trends

Mitha Tiwana (Pakistan) has a hot semi-arid climate (BSh) under the Köppen-Geiger classification. Its mean annual temperature is 24.0 °C and it receives 586 mm of precipitation per year.

These figures are normals computed over 86 complete calendar years, from 1940 to 2025, using ERA5 reanalysis data from the Copernicus programme.

The warmest month is June (34.8 °C on average) and the coldest is January (11.6 °C). Rainfall peaks in July.

Mitha Tiwana averages 0 frost days, 209 hot days (≥ 30 °C) and 83 rainy days per year.

No statistically significant temperature trend emerges for Mitha Tiwana between 1940 and 2025: over this span, year-to-year swings outweigh the climate signal.

The hottest day of the period reached 49.2 °C (on 7 June 1978) and the coldest -3.6 °C (on 10 February 1950).
